🎉 Задачи по Python, способы сортировки и плохие программисты. Наши лучшие статьи за 2022 год

Итоги 2022 года: 336 опубликованных статей, Питон традиционно в ТОПе, а слово года — релокация.

1. 🐍🧩 5 классических задач по Python для начинающих с решениями

Подборка интересных задач по Python разной степени сложности с решениями: задача Иосифа Флавия, заполнение матрицы по спирали, ходы шахматного ферзя, разделение на подсписки и магический квадрат.

Для кого:

  • для энтузиастов Python.

2. 🐍 40 проектов на Python для новичков и продвинутых разработчиков

Сорок проектов для начинающих и продвинутых программистов: консольные, десктопные, веб- и ИИ-приложения. Также указан список полезного инструментария и библиотек, который поможет в реализации проектов.

Для кого:

  • для практиков.

3. 🖥️🎥 Прощай, Zoom: ТОП-13 альтернативных отечественных сервисов видеоконференций

Когда срочно нужно собрать коллег за экраном, а Zoom приказал долго жить – выбираем отечественные аналоги.

Для кого:

  • для деловых.

4. 👨‍💻❌ 4 признака плохого программиста

Как определить дилетанта и непрофессионала в своем окружении? Какие качества присущи плохому разработчику? Если нашли у себя больше половины, то это повод призадуматься.

Для кого:

  • для каждого программиста.

5. ➕ ➕ 7 способов сортировки массивов на примере С++ с иллюстрациями

В этой статье продемонстрируем на иллюстрациях, как работают алгоритмы сортировки: от простейшей пузырьковой до сложной древовидной кучи. Также определим сложность худших и лучших случаев, а код напишем на С++.

Для кого:

  • для тех, кто любит книги с картинками.

6. 🎞️ Улучшение видео нейросетью: ТОП 3 программ (бесплатные и платные)

Применение нейросетей и искусственного интеллекта стали неотъемлемой частью нашей жизни. Обработка видео – одна из сфер, где возможности ИИ используют очень активно. В этом материале мы расскажем о приемах и программах, которые помогают повысить качество видеоконтента.

Для кого:

  • для продвинутых.

7. ☕ ТОП-20 бесплатных учебных курсов по Java для новичков

Популярность Java не спадает и только набирает обороты. Представляем лучшие бесплатные курсы для его изучения начинающим разработчикам.

Для кого:

  • для тех, кто хочет высокую ЗП.
  • для тех, кто готов продать свою душу богу энтерпрайза.

8. 🌏 ТОП-6 стран для переезда в 2022 году: советы по релокейту для айтишника

Сложная политическая и экономическая ситуация заставляет опытных специалистов задуматься об эмиграции. Делимся информацией о происходящем.

Для кого:

  • для открытых всему новому.

9. 🙌 12 алгоритмов, которые должен знать каждый разработчик: объясняем на гифках

Алгоритмы давно заняли особую нишу как в Computer Science, так и в разработке ПО. Однако какую роль они играют в жизни разработчика и что конкретно из них следует изучить и знать? Об этом вы узнаете из нашей статьи.

Для кого:

  • для всех.

10. 🔥 Как креативно оформить профиль на GitHub, чтобы он привлекал внимание

В этой статье мы создадим привлекательный профиль на GitHub: добавим гифки, эмодзи, иконки социальных сетей, GitHub-статистику, ТОП языков программирования и многое другое. Код прилагается.

Для кого:

  • для тех, кто ищет работу.
  • для ценителей красоты.
***

Материалы по теме

ЛУЧШИЕ СТАТЬИ ПО ТЕМЕ

kapo4ka
15 ноября 2019

7 языков программирования, которые ты должен знать в 2020 году

Какой язык учить, чтобы стать востребованным разработчиком? Ловите ТОП-7 яз...